Macaroni and Cheese V
This was a great recipe, my whole family loved it and my husband, who hates leftovers was searching the fridge for it the next day. It is a great recipe for people with toddlers or small children because they love it and it makes a great and easy lunch the next day. I also add a little paprika for a little more flavour. I also like to make a little more cheese sauce, so if there are leftovers it is still great(and cheesy) the next day.
